Their are some approach ways to manage bedwetting (enuresis). Here are changes you can make at home that may help: Limit how much your child drinks in the evening. It's important to get enough fluids so their is no need to limit how much your child drinks in a day. However, encourage your child to focus on drinking liquids in the morning and early afternoon, which may reduce thirst in the evening. But don't limit evening fluids if your child participates in sports practice or games in the evenings. Avoid beverages and foods with caffeine. Beverages with caffeine are discouraged for children at any time of day because caffeine may stimulate the bladder, it's especially discouraged in the evening. Encourage regular toilet use throughout the day. During the day and evening, suggest that your child urinate every two hours or so, or at least often enough to avoid a feeling of urgency.
